DEKALB JUNCTION -- Registered physician assistant (PA) Brittani Bickel has joined the medical staff of St. Lawrence Health System’s Gouverneur Hospital.
Ms. Bickel earned her certificate of physician studies at LeMoyne College in Syracuse in 2007.
She completed rotations in general surgery, geriatrics/psychiatry, emergency medicine, family practice/primary care, and women’s health.
“I truly enjoy being able to promote health and wellness, as well as providing care to our rural, underserved communities,” Ms. Bickel stated.
PAs are licensed medical professionals who work under the guidance of a physician.
They conduct physical examinations, diagnose illnesses, prescribe medications, and are qualified to assist in a multitude of medical and surgical procedures.
PAs order and interpret diagnostic tests, perform suturing and castings, and work beside physicians in the operating room.
